One of the most frequently reported BPC 157 adverse effects relates to the administration method. For injections, common issues include pain and swelling at the injection site, as well as potential for infection or allergic reaction. Some users have described injection site soreness, headaches, and digestive discomfort.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) has specifically cautioned that BPC 157 may pose a risk of immunogenicity, meaning it could trigger an immune response in the body. This concern is echoed in discussions about compounded drugs containing BPC-157, which may pose a risk for immunogenicity for certain routes of administration. Furthermore, the unregulated nature of BPC-157 means there's a potential for allergic reactions, hormonal imbalances, and unforeseen systemic effects. The long-term safety profile of BPC-157, including the short-term and long-term safety of its intake, remains largely unknown. This lack of comprehensive human trials means the FDA cannot assure the safety of BPC-157, including potential side effects and long-term impacts.

Some studies and user reports have indicated other potential adverse events. These can include inflammation, fever, or abscess formation at the injection site. The lack of robust clinical data is a significant impediment to fully understanding the risks associated with BPC 157. While preclinical safety evaluations in animals like mice, rats, rabbits, and dogs have shown that BPC157 was well tolerated and did not cause serious toxicity, these findings do not directly translate to human safety. The FDA has added BPC-157 to its list of substances presenting significant safety risks, citing concerns about immune reactions.
